Definition
A menu option that sets the time within which the user
must disarm the partition before a full alarm occurs. This
time can be between 10 and 255 seconds.
A menu option that sets the time within which the user
must leave the protected zone after arming the partition
before a full alarm occurs. When arming in Away mode, the
keypad can beep to warn the user (see keypad menu
options), also System Arming, Leave Now screen displays
until the end of the exit delay time. This time can be
between 10 and 255 seconds.
A menu entry that groups all optional features relating to
partitions.
A menu entry that groups the arming characteristics of the
selected partition.
A menu option that enables the function keys for part
arming and for full arming. These options work on a single-
partition keypad only. If the Quick Arm menu option is
enabled, the user can arm the system by simply pressing
the Arm Away, Arm Stay or Night Mode button, otherwise it
is necessary to enter the user code first. (To arm a system
in the Away mode with a single-partition keypad it is
enough to enter the user code).
A menu option that enables the exit delay without
disarming the partition.
The exit delay can be restarted if in arm stay mode by
using the Arm Away command in the user menu or by
pressing a function key programmed by the installer to
activate arm away.
A menu option that arms the partition automatically at a
preset time without the keypad buzzer sounding.
A menu option that enables the automatic instant feature
of entry zones.
If no exit is detected (the entry/exit zone is not opened and
closed) after the partition is armed, the entry delay timer is
cancelled, creating an instant zone. If the exit is detected
(the user leaves the premises after arming the partition),
the entry timer stays active, creating an entry delay.
A menu option applicable for secondary entry/exit zones
only (zones with Delay 2 option set).
If the final set door option is enabled, the exit time will
immediately expire as soon as the secondary entry/exit
zone becomes ready again (the door is opened and closed
when the user leaves the premises). This feature can only
be used in combination with magnetic door contacts.
A menu option that enables the instant Night mode
selection from the keypad (no toggle). In this mode, the
control panel will bypass all zones that have the Entry
Guard feature enabled, and the partition will be armed
without an exit delay. The partition must be disarmed to
cancel this mode.
